About the Destinations

ephesus-and-pamukkale-tour-from-istanbul-by-flight-with-hotel

Ephesus, once a thriving ancient Greek city, is renowned for its remarkably well-preserved ruins that offer a glimpse into the grandeur of the past.

Visitors can wander through the magnificent Library of Celsus, the impressive Great Theater, and the ancient streets lined with restored temples and monuments.

Visitors can explore the magnificence of the Library of Celsus, the grand Great Theater, and the restored ancient streets.

In contrast, Pamukkale, meaning "cotton castle" in Turkish, is a natural wonder. Its striking white terraces, formed by the cascading warm mineral waters, create a unique and mesmerizing landscape.

Visitors can explore the ancient ruins of Hierapolis and soak in the therapeutic thermal pools, an experience that’s both relaxing and rejuvenating.
